DP World Tour launch G4D (Golf for the Disabled) Tour

The DP World Tour has reinforced its commitment to inclusivity in the game of golf with the launch of the newly named G4D (Golf for the Disabled) Tour.

The G4D Tour incorporates an expanded 2022 schedule and a package of financial, commercial and media support for the European Disabled Golf Association (EDGA).

As part of the agreement, the 2022 G4D Tour's international schedule will feature a minimum of seven tournaments - increased from five in 2021 - with new events taking place at the Betfred British Masters hosted by Danny Willett, the Porsche European Open, the BMW PGA Championship and the Estrella Damm N.A Andalucia Masters.

The DP World Tour, through the European Tour group's Golf for Good initiative, has also committed to a financial support package which will see European Disabled Golf Association move from a volunteer-based organisation to a semi-professional one.

The 2022 G4D Tour schedule features seven events in six different countries. The stars of G4D will tee off their season at The Belfry in England, from May 2-3, ahead of the Betfred British Masters hosted by Danny Willett.

The Tour will then land in Germany for the first time ahead of June's Porsche European Open, before Mount Juliet Estate plays host ahead of the Horizon Irish Open. The ISPS Handa World Invitational Presented by Modest! Golf Management will once again welcome the G4D Tour from August 8-9 at Galgorm Resort in Northern Ireland.

For the first time, the G4D Tour will visit Wentworth Club ahead of the prestigious BMW PGA Championship - a Rolex Series event - from September 5-6, before taking on Spain's famous Real Club Valderrama for the first time from October 10-11, ahead of the Estrella Damm N.A. Andalucía Masters.
